BHT401 Chemical Processing of Textiles-I Unit-Wise Syllabus

Official AKTU syllabus (effective 2023-24) — 5 units.

Unit 1

Role of water & its quality for wet processing, hard water and soft water. Basic concepts of surfactants in textile processing, Natural and added impurities in textiles, Preparatory process sequences for cotton, wool, silk, polyester, nylon, acrylic and blends.

Unit 2: Singeing

Singeing: Gas singeing, Desizing: Hydrolytic and Oxidative systems, Scouring: Solvent, Conventional and Enzymatic systems, Bleaching with Sodium hypochlorite, Hydrogen peroxide, Sodium chlorite. Optical brightening agents (OBA), mechanism and its application on all fibres. Mercerization of cotton, physical and chemical aspects of mercerization, yarn and fabric mercerizing.

Unit 3

Preparatory processes for protein fibres, wool: Carbonization, scouring, bleaching. Degumming and bleaching of silk. Preparatory processes for synthetic fibres and blends: Objective of heat setting, types of heat setting, working of stenters. Scouring and bleaching of synthetic fibres and blends. Assessment of desizing, scouring, bleaching and mercerization.

Unit 4

Brief introduction to preparatory processing machineries – Batch machines: Pressure Kiers, Vaporloc machines, Jigger, Winch, Semi continuous and continuous machines: J-Box, Padding mangles

Unit 5: Outcomes

General Consideration and classification of textile auxiliaries, Preparation of detergents, comparison between soaps and detergents, Physical principles involved in detergency conditions for efficient detergency. BHT401 Reference Books

  1. A glimpse on the chemical technology and textile fibres by R.R.Chackrawartt
  2. Technology of bleaching and mercerization by V.A.Shenai
  3. Technology of finishing by V.A.Shenai
  4. Scouring and Bleaching by E.R. Trotman
  5. Textile Preparation and Dyeing by Asim Kumar Roy Choudhury
